Ben Shelton arrives at the Miami Open 2026 with better feelings after overcoming a viral process that conditioned him in Indian Wells. "I woke up every morning feeling like I couldn't even stand and with no energy," confessed the American, who had to shorten points and rely on his serve to compete. Now recovered, he hopes to have a great performance in a tournament that historically has not been particularly good for him. "When I started on the circuit, I didn't like fast courts, I felt like I didn't have time to play my game. But over time, I'm feeling more comfortable with the low bounce and speed of the court. I hope to have a good tournament here because I believe the conditions suit my game well," concluded the American.
